From Grzegorz.Banasiak at ipv6.cbr.tpsa.pl Fri Aug 13 01:58:19 2004 From: Grzegorz.Banasiak at ipv6.cbr.tpsa.pl (Grzegorz Banasiak) Date: Fri Aug 13 01:59:04 2004 Subject: [6bone] Solaris 9 + IPv6 Message-ID: <411C82AB.80201@ipv6.cbr.tpsa.pl> Hello everyone, I've got a few questions regarding Solaris 9 OS and IPv6 protocol. I would be grateful if anyone could answer any of those: 1) /etc/defaultrouter for IPv6 Is there any "decent" place where one may specify default route for IPv6, like in /etc/defaultrouter for IPv4? Assumptions: There is no IPv6-enabled router in the LAN, so Ethernet interface is not configured for IPv6 (no /etc/hostname6.if_name). Solaris box that I am thinking of has only a static IPv6 over IPv4 tunnel (/etc/hostname6.ip.tun0). 2) Did you encounter any problems with RPC after activation of IPv6? [..] Aug 4 11:07:52 mars rpcbind: [ID 489175 daemon.error] Unable to join IPv6 multicast group for rpc broadcast FF02::202 [..] Aug 4 11:08:11 mars ip: [ID 603775 kern.notice] ip_queue_to_ill_v6: no ill Aug 4 11:08:26 mars last message repeated 3 times Aug 4 11:08:41 mars /usr/dt/bin/ttsession[454]: [ID 161973 daemon.error] t_connect(): System error Aug 4 11:08:41 mars last message repeated 1 time [..] ttsession fails and I cannot log into CDE environment which makes the system unusable from my point of view. Assumptions: Again, only a static IPv6 over IPv4 tunnel. IPv6 is not enabled on the Ethernet interface. Should I activate IPv6 also on Ethernet interface, even if there is no logical need for this? 3) firewall on the host What are my options today? Any free solution? Any stateful solution? For IPv4, IP Filter (AKA ipf) is just enough for me. Cheers, -- Grzegorz Banasiak IPv6 Project Research and Development Department, Telekomunikacja Polska S.A. From mohacsi at niif.hu Fri Aug 13 03:40:23 2004 From: mohacsi at niif.hu (Mohacsi Janos) Date: Fri Aug 13 03:41:02 2004 Subject: [6bone] Solaris 9 + IPv6 In-Reply-To: <411C82AB.80201@ipv6.cbr.tpsa.pl> References: <411C82AB.80201@ipv6.cbr.tpsa.pl> Message-ID: <20040813123644.A82373@mignon.ki.iif.hu> On Fri, 13 Aug 2004, Grzegorz Banasiak wrote: > > 3) firewall on the host > > What are my options today? Any free solution? Any stateful solution? > For IPv4, IP Filter (AKA ipf) is just enough for me. For IPv6 you can use ipf also. Add -6 option for ipf or ipfstat. The ipmon does not support IPv6 yet. We are using ipf with IPv6 in production on FreeBSD. Regards, Janos Mohacsi Network Engineer, Research Associate NIIF/HUNGARNET, HUNGARY Key 00F9AF98: 8645 1312 D249 471B DBAE 21A2 9F52 0D1F 00F9 AF98
